The 18650 lithium-ion battery gets its name from its cylindrical shape and dimensions. Specifically, '18' refers to the diameter of the battery in millimeters (18mm), while '65' refers to its length in millimeters (65mm). The '0' denotes that it's a cylindrical cell. This battery type is renowned for its high energy density, long cycle life, and lightweight characteristics, making it an ideal choice for both consumer electronics and industrial applications.
The versatility of the 18650 battery makes it suitable for an extensive range of applications, including:
From laptops and smartphones to portable chargers, 18650 batteries power the devices we use daily. The lightweight and compact design allows electronics manufacturers to create sleeker, more efficient products.
The automotive industry has increasingly adopted 18650 batteries, particularly in electric vehicles and hybrid models. Their high energy capacity supports the extended range needed for modern EVs, ensuring that drivers can travel longer distances without frequent recharges.
Vaping devices often utilize 18650 batteries due to their ability to deliver high current output while maintaining stability over repeated charge cycles. Users appreciate how efficiently these batteries can power their devices, allowing for a better vaping experience.
The construction and manufacturing sectors frequently utilize 18650 batteries for power tools. Their compact size enables battery-powered tools to be lightweight yet powerful, assisting professionals in completing tasks more efficiently.

The future of 18650 lithium-ion batteries looks bright as advancements in battery technology continue to emerge. Research is underway to enhance energy density, charge times, and safety features. New applications in renewable energy storage, as well as advancements in electric vehicle technology, may also expand the utility and demand for these versatile batteries.
Moreover, as consumer awareness increases regarding environmental impact, manufacturers might focus more on sustainable practices in battery production. Emerging technologies like solid-state batteries could further revolutionize the market, offering users even safer and more efficient energy storage options.
